What is an entry level data analyst r programming?

An Entry Level Data Analyst (R Programming) is a professional who uses the R programming language to collect, process, and analyze data to help organizations make informed decisions. They typically work with large datasets, create visualizations, and generate reports under the guidance of more experienced analysts. Entry-level data analysts are often responsible for basic data cleaning, statistical analysis, and supporting team projects while they develop their skills in R and data analysis techniques.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as an entry level data analyst r programming?

To thrive as an Entry Level Data Analyst specializing in R Programming, you need a solid grounding in statistics, data cleaning, and analytical methods, typically supported by a relevant degree such as statistics, mathematics, or computer science. Proficiency in R programming, familiarity with data visualization tools (e.g., ggplot2), and experience with spreadsheet software or SQL are commonly required. Strong att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and clear communication skills set outstanding candidates apart in this role. These skills are crucial to accurately interpret data, deliver actionable insights, and effectively collaborate with teams to support data-driven decision-making.

What are some typical challenges entry level data analysts face when working with R programming in a team setting?

Entry-level data analysts using R often encounter challenges such as adapting to existing codebases, understanding team-specific data workflows, and ensuring code reproducibility and documentation for collaborative projects. New analysts may also need to quickly learn version control practices (like using Git) and follow standardized procedures for data cleaning and reporting. Regular communication with senior analysts and participation in code reviews are essential to build both technical proficiency and teamwork skills.

What is the difference between Entry Level Data Analyst R Programming vs Data Scientist?

AspectEntry Level Data Analyst R ProgrammingData Scientist
Required SkillsBasic R programming, data cleaning, visualization, ExcelAdvanced R, Python, machine learning, statistical modeling
Work EnvironmentBusiness, finance, marketing teamsResearch, tech, healthcare, diverse industries
CertificationsData analysis, R programming coursesData science, machine learning certifications

Entry Level Data Analyst R Programming roles focus on data cleaning, visualization, and basic analysis using R, often within business environments. Data Scientists require advanced statistical and programming skills, including machine learning, and work on complex predictive models across various industries. While both roles involve data handling, Data Scientists typically have a broader skill set and handle more complex projects.
